Section 104 Nigerian Electricity Act 2023

Section 104 Electricity Act 2023

Section 104 of the Electricity Act 2023 is about Directives by the President. It is under Part VIII (Establishment of the National Hydroelectric Power Producing Areas Development Commission) of the Act.

(1) Subject to the provisions of this Act, the President may give to the N-HYPPADEC directives of a general nature or relating generally to matters or policy with regards to the performance of its functions and the N-HYPPADEC shall comply with the directives.

(2) The N-HYPPADEC shall, with the approval of the President make regulations generally for the purpose of giving effect to this Act.
